Enhanced One Health Surveillance during the 58th Presidential Inauguration-District of Columbia, January 2017.

Abstract
OBJECTIVE
In January 2017, Washington, DC, hosted the 58th United States presidential inauguration. The DC Department of Health leveraged multiple health surveillance approaches, including syndromic surveillance (human and animal) and medical aid station-based patient tracking, to detect disease and injury associated with this mass gathering.
METHODS
Patient data were collected from a regional syndromic surveillance system, medical aid stations, and an internet-based emergency department reporting system. Animal health data were collected from DC veterinary facilities.
RESULTS
Of 174 703 chief complaints from human syndromic data, there were 6 inauguration-related alerts. Inauguration attendees who visited aid stations (n = 162) and emergency departments (n = 180) most commonly reported feeling faint/dizzy (n = 29; 17.9%) and pain/cramps (n = 34;18.9%). In animals, of 533 clinical signs reported, most were gastrointestinal (n = 237; 44.5%) and occurred in canines (n = 374; 70.2%). Ten animals that presented dead on arrival were investigated; no significant threats were identified.
CONCLUSION
Use of multiple surveillance systems allowed for near-real-time detection and monitoring of disease and injury syndromes in humans and domestic animals potentially associated with inaugural events and in local health care systems.
